THE LAST FIVE YEARS

WRITTEN AND COMPOSED BY JASON ROBERT BROWN

BELINDA DUNBAR

THE LAST FIVE YEARS WRITTEN AND COMPOSED BY JASON ROBERT BROWN
Presented by The Brainbox Project
Tuesday 18 to Saturday 29 May 2010
DownStairs at the Maj, His Majesty’s Theatre 825 Hay St, Perth
Directed by BELINDA DUNBAR
Musical Director TIM CUNNIFFE
Featuring BRENDAN HANSON and SHARON WISNIEWSKI with a four piece band - cello, violin, guitar and piano

The Last Five Years is an emotionally powerful and intimate musical set in New York that chronicles the path of a young couple as they fall in and out of love with each other over a five year period. It explores the many everyday human flaws that get in the way after the first initial flush of passion that love brings is over as well as the sorrow of mismatched expectations.

For Jamie the story begins on the day he meets his ‘Shiksa Goddess’, but for Cathy, the story starts at the end of their relationship and this beautiful tale told only through song, with no dialogue, takes you right to the centre of the two journeys in such a heartfelt way you will be singing all the way home believing that just maybe true love could happen, if only the circumstances were right.

The New York Times has hailed the Tony award winning Jason Robert Brown as "a leading member of a new generation of composers who embody high hopes for the American musical ”. He won Drama Desk Awards for the music and the lyrics with the musical style drawing on a number of genres, including pop, jazz, classical, klezmer, latin, rock, and folk.

Funny and uplifting, the show captures some of the most heartbreaking and universally felt moments of modern romance. Tripod.com

Brown’s musical pastiches are...satirical and cleverly constructed, ranging from vintage Broadway to acoustic rock’n’roll. The Independent, UK

STIRLING PLAYERS YOUTH – WRITERS PROJECT
For youth aged 12-25 years OR a new adult writer who has not had any of their work presented in public before.
Theme: “Last Resorts”
SPY wishes to announce an exciting opportunity for new and young writers.
If you’re interested in giving play writing a go, or if you have something you have already developed which fits in with the theme “Last Resorts,” we encourage you to submit a script to be produced by SPY!
It can be in any genre and style you wish, and is expected to be 15-20 minutes in length.
The scripts will be assessed and undergo an editing process between the writer and project co-ordinator, with the most compatible scripts being chosen to be performed for a three night season at Stirling Theatre in October.
CONDITIONS:
please email expression of interest as soon as possible to the email address below.
• Submissions open from 9th April until 30th June, with 2-4 scripts being chosen. NO LATE ENTRIES WILL BE ACCEPTED.
• The theme of the project is “Last Resorts,” and we’ll be looking for your interpretation of this theme in your script.
• As the goal of this project is to assist young and new writers in building scripts, please be aware that if your script is selected it will be subject to editing and re-working, in consultation with the writer.
• A director chosen by the project co-ordinator will be allocated to produce each selected script, with auditions being held on 25th July. Once the editing process is complete, the director has full discretion regarding the writer’s involvement in the rehearsal process.
• Writers need to be in the age group of 12-25 years OR a new adult writer who has not had any of their work presented in public before.
• Plays may be 20 minutes in length AT MOST.
• The stage will have no flats and will be using the tab curtains for entrances and exits, so keep this in mind when choosing the setting of your play.
• Small cast plays are preferred. (A minimum of 2 and a maximum of 6 cast members).
• Any genre or style is acceptable.
